Default Things are looking Tough in Montana

For anyone looking at hunting in Eastern Montana, beware that we are having an extremely tough winter... Lots of snow and bitter cold with a lot of wind and it started in Mid -December and hasn't let up. We were -37 below here yesterday morning. Deer are living in the haystacks and shelterbelts where they can. We're going to have some winterkill. How much is hard to say. My concern is that in past years after a tough winter, EHD seems to be much more prevalent. I don't know if the deers' immune system is weakened after a hard winter or what, but more often than not we see a die off from EHD in late summer after a hard winter... I'm no biologist by any means...that's just what I've observed over the years....
